The ingredients needed to make Sultan Chicken Broccoli Potato Au Gratin:
  1. Make ready boneless chicken breast
  2. Prepare 1 large potato
  3. Make ready head broccoli -rinsed & chopped
  4. Take cream of broccoli can soup
  5. Prepare cheddar broccoli powdered soup mix (optional)
  6. Prepare chopped onion
  7. Get curry
  8. Prepare fenugreek
  9. Get citric acid (limesalt)
  10. Get tumeric
  11. Make ready mozzarella
Instructions to make Sultan Chicken Broccoli Potato Au Gratin:
  1. Thick slice potato (like large coins) -boil until tender
  2. Heat mix cream of broccoli/cheddar broccoli soup mix & water (min 10 min)
  3. Slice chicken semi-thin, add to hot olive oil & onion in skillet (seasoning with pinches of limesalt, curry, & fenugreek. -optional pinches of turmeric for color)
  4. In a casserole dish, layer soup mix, broccoli, potato, chicken, and mozzarella. Leaving mozzarella as final topping
  5. Bake at 375 for 30 min, or until cheese is bubbling brown
  6. We serve in bowls with French baguette or fresh khubz
  7. Our casserole dish was already overflowing with plenty of extra left over ingredients. We layered in another casserole dish and fridge stored for cooking the next day. The flavors really developed overnight, and it was AMAZING(!!!!) lunch dish.
